Arroyo

Noun CEFR B1
əˈɹɔɪ.əʊ

Definitions

  1. A dry creek or streambed, a gulch which temporarily or seasonally fills and flows (after sufficient rain).
  2. A surname from Spanish.
  3. Any watercourse; any rivulet (whether it flows year-round or only seasonally).
